Patents by Inventor MANISH KATARIA

MANISH KATARIA has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 9565524
    Abstract: A method for accessing location-based information on a mobile device. In the method, a processor on the mobile device identifies a location, determines whether a location wireless network is available, determines geographical coordinates of the location in response to determining that the location wireless network is not available, calculates a URL using the geographical coordinates and calculates a default HTML, and displays one or more pages created by the default HTML that includes information of the location.
    Type: Grant
    Filed: March 23, 2015
    Date of Patent: February 7, 2017
    Assignee: International Business Machines Corporation
    Inventors: Vimal Dhupar, Manish Kataria
  • Publication number: 20170034655
    Abstract: A computer system for accessing location-based information on a mobile device. The computer system determines whether a default HTML including information of a location is available, in response to determining that a wireless network at the location is available. The computer system determines geographical coordinates of the location and calculates a URL and the default HTML using the geographical coordinates, in response to determining that the wireless network at the location is not available and in response to determining that the default HTML is not available. The computer system displays one or more pages created by the default HTML that is calculated. The computer system displays the one or more pages created by the default HTML that is available, in response to determining that the default HTML is available.
    Type: Application
    Filed: October 18, 2016
    Publication date: February 2, 2017
    Inventors: Vimal Dhupar, Manish Kataria
  • Publication number: 20170026477
    Abstract: A computer program product for accessing location-based information on a mobile device. The computer program product determines whether a default HTML including information of a location is available, in response to determining that a wireless network at the location is available. The computer program product determines geographical coordinates of the location and calculates a URL and the default HTML using the geographical coordinates, in response to determining that the wireless network at the location is not available and in response to determining that the default HTML is not available. The computer program product displays one or more pages created by the default HTML that is calculated. The computer program product displays the one or more pages created by the default HTML that is available, in response to determining that the default HTML is available.
    Type: Application
    Filed: October 13, 2016
    Publication date: January 26, 2017
    Inventors: Vimal Dhupar, Manish Kataria
  • Publication number: 20160286347
    Abstract: A method for accessing location-based information on a mobile device. In the method, a processor on the mobile device identifies a location, determines whether a location wireless network is available, determines geographical coordinates of the location in response to determining that the location wireless network is not available, calculates a URL using the geographical coordinates and calculates a default HTML, and displays one or more pages created by the default HTML that includes information of the location.
    Type: Application
    Filed: March 23, 2015
    Publication date: September 29, 2016
    Inventors: Vimal Dhupar, Manish Kataria
  • Publication number: 20160283448
    Abstract: A method for accessing location-based information on a mobile device. In the method, a processor on the mobile device identifies a location, determines whether a location wireless network is available, determines geographical coordinates of the location in response to determining that the location wireless network is not available, calculates a URL using the geographical coordinates and calculates a default HTML, and displays one or more pages created by the default HTML.
    Type: Application
    Filed: December 18, 2015
    Publication date: September 29, 2016
    Inventors: Vimal Dhupar, Manish Kataria
  • Patent number: 9443213
    Abstract: Adapting web-based applications in a client/server web-based architecture is provided. At least a first version and a second version of a client/server application is provided. An adaptable application platform monitors a client and a server in a client/server web-based architecture for one or more performance characteristics. If one or more configurable performance characteristics exceeds a threshold, the adaptable application platform switches dynamically between executing the first version to executing the second version. The first version is server preferring and the second version is client preferring.
    Type: Grant
    Filed: March 23, 2016
    Date of Patent: September 13, 2016
    Assignee: International Business Machines Corporation
    Inventors: Manish Kataria, Maureen G. Leland, Martin J. C. Presler-Marshall
  • Patent number: 9436446
    Abstract: A method, a computer program product, and a computer system for automating calculation of a comprehensibility score for a software program. An analytics engine on a computer matches tokens of the software program with a language dictionary, a domain specific vocabulary, and a language grammar. The analytics engine determines a comprehensibility score for the software program, based on matching tokens. The analytics engine provides the comprehensibility score to a reviewer evaluating the software program.
    Type: Grant
    Filed: November 16, 2015
    Date of Patent: September 6, 2016
    Assignee: International Business Machines Corporation
    Inventors: Vivek K. Gupta, Manish Kataria, Nihar Tiku
  • Publication number: 20160179978
    Abstract: A list of performed operations is received containing all operations performed in an order of processing. A request from a user is received including at least one of an undo request of a last performed operation or a redo request of a last performed undo request from the list of performed operations and the request includes at least one content type. A content type of each performed operation in the list of performed operations is determined. All performed operations from the list of performed operations that have a content type the same as one content type of the at least one content types is determined. The at least one of an undo request of a last performed operation or redo request of the last performed undo request from the list of performed operations that have one content type of the at least one content types is performed.
    Type: Application
    Filed: December 22, 2014
    Publication date: June 23, 2016
    Inventors: Vimal Dhupar, Manish Kataria
  • Publication number: 20130173700
    Abstract: A method can include evaluating each of a plurality of collaborative systems, using a processor, for suitability hosting an artifact according to at least one attribute of the artifact. A first collaborative system can be selected from the plurality of collaborative systems according to the evaluation. The artifact can be stored in the first collaborative system.
    Type: Application
    Filed: December 29, 2011
    Publication date: July 4, 2013
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: THOMAS J. BURRIS, MANISH KATARIA
  • Publication number: 20130173703
    Abstract: A method can include evaluating each of a plurality of collaborative systems, using a processor, for suitability hosting an artifact according to at least one attribute of the artifact. A first collaborative system can be selected from the plurality of collaborative systems according to the evaluation. The artifact can be stored in the first collaborative system.
    Type: Application
    Filed: July 30, 2012
    Publication date: July 4, 2013
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: THOMAS J. BURRIS, MANISH KATARIA
  • Publication number: 20110320479
    Abstract: At least one unique collection of storage artifacts can be specified to indicate that the storage artifact is a member of the unique collection. Each storage artifact can be a discrete object comprising digitally encoded content that is stored as a node within a tree structure of a tangible storage medium. The collection can be referenced by a set of different storage artifacts to form a collection of related storage artifacts. Each storage artifact can correspond to different collections, wherein membership within a collection is independent of a storage path within the tree structure. A file management action relating to the storage artifact can be performed. The file management action can be dependent upon the storage artifact being a member of the unique collection.
    Type: Application
    Filed: June 29, 2010
    Publication date: December 29, 2011
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: THOMAS J. BURRIS, BHAVAN KUMAR KASIVAJJULA, MANISH KATARIA, ANURAG SRIVASTAVA